Why You Need a Collaborating Physician in Charlotte
Compliance and Legal Oversight Made Simple
In North Carolina, physician collaboration is not optional for many clinics. Oversight requirements set by the NC Medical Board and the Board of Nursing define how nurse practitioners, physician assistants, and delegated medical services must operate, especially when prescriptive authority is involved.
With the right primary supervising physician from our network of North Carolina collaborating physicians, your clinic receives support that includes:
Physician supervision or collaboration aligned with North Carolina regulations
Your supervising physician helps ensure services are delegated appropriately and delivered within state guidelines, protecting both your providers and your practice.
Review of prescriptive authority and clinical protocols
Protocols and prescribing workflows are reviewed to align with North Carolina law, reducing uncertainty and helping your team operate with clarity.
Chart review and quality assurance oversight
Ongoing chart review and quality checks support patient safety, consistency of care, and strong clinical documentation.
Supervising physician and collaborative practice agreements
We help put the right agreements in place, so your physician relationship is clearly defined, properly documented, and aligned with NC requirements.
Ongoing compliance documentation and audit readiness
From routine oversight to audit preparation, your clinic stays organized and ready, lowering regulatory risk over time.
